Patagonia's recycled-nylon shell and 800-fill responsible down make this parka a long-haul daily driver
The Patagonia Durable Down Parka is built for the kind of daily use that wears out lighter down jackets at the cuffs, the hem, and anywhere a pack strap rides. The Ultra-PE ripstop shell pairs a solvent-free acrylic coating and PFAS-free DWR finish with genuine abrasion resistance, so the jacket holds its shape and finish through seasons of commutes, travel days, and trail approaches. The Pertex Quantum NetPlus lining, woven from postconsumer recycled fishing nets, adds a smooth interior that layers cleanly over midlayers without bunching.

Details
- Down parka for hiking, travel, and daily wear in cold conditions
- 800-fill Responsible Down Standard insulation for serious warmth at low weight
- Ultra-PE ripstop shell resists abrasion where lighter jackets wear through first
- Pertex Quantum NetPlus lining woven from postconsumer recycled fishing nets
- PFAS-free DWR finish on both shell and lining
- Regular fit with fixed hood and two zippered hand pockets
